✨ Fill and validate PDF forms with InstaFill AI. Save an average of 34 minutes on each form, reducing mistakes by 90% and ensuring accuracy. Learn more

Senior Software Engineer

EmployBridge Smyrna, Georgia
senior senior software engineer software engineer design web cloud team software engineering agile cloud applications senior
December 2, 2022
EmployBridge
Smyrna, Georgia
FULL_TIME

Responsibilities

As a cloud developer in an Agile development environment, you will contribute to the design, development, and maintenance of cloud applications across the full stack. Your responsibilities will include the following:

  • Performing senior software engineering tasks related to the functional and technical design of the application scope entrusted to your team
  • Participating in the technical and architectural decision-making process with project stakeholders
  • Developing front-end web solutions and user interfaces based on product specifications and/or marketing designs.
  • Developing responsive web pages for cross-platform rendering, including mobile devices
  • Developing web services, applications and back-end databases
  • Developing automated tests
  • Deploying solutions to the target environment.
  • Documenting solutions and processes within the scope of your development activities
  • Committing to a culture of continuous improvement for your team:
  • improving existing applications through performance enhancements, code refactoring and bug fixes
  • Providing senior-level guidance and support to other team members
  • participating in code reviews
  • staying up to date with emerging technologies and industry best practices

Qualifications

  • B.S. in Computer Science or a related engineering discipline.
  • 4+ years of experience in a full-stack web development role
  • Experience developing web application software, including all layers of the web stack
  • Experience with HTML/CSS/Typescript/JavaScript
  • Experience with React
  • Source code control experience, in particular Git and GitLab
  • API development
  • Experience with continuous integration and continuous deployment of cloud applications (CI/CD)
  • Experience with object-oriented design and OO design tools
  • Familiarity with all aspects of the software engineering lifecycle (design, coding, revision control, bug tracking, etc.)
  • Strong written and oral communications skills.
  • Strong desire and proven track record working in a team environment

The following skills are a plus:

  • Cloud infrastructure development in Azure and AWS in a server less application
  • Data analytics
  • Exposure to Design Patterns, Unit testing, and test-driven development
  • Experience with Angular
  • Kotlin experience
  • IoT experience
  • Agile techniques
  • C#/.NET (IoT data collection agent)


Report this job

Similar jobs near me

Related articles